Hi,

I used to got black screen reply from apple. The reason is that I assume apple will have same country setting like mine. And my code has a bug when users have different language setting. Just for your reference.

Bob [import]uid: 20999 topic_id: 24156 reply_id: 97516[/import]

Just chiming in to say I’ve been in the same situation as bobyeh - and have now learned to test for a few different language settings before releasing an app. I got a black screen because of this, and it took a while before I figured the problem out. So - even though it could be a million different things - it’s one of the variables that can differ on the devices, so it’s worth checking out! Hey, Jeff, which Corona build are you using for the release? And about the “black screen”, can you tell what it should look like instead? If the “black screen” bit is where text should’ve appeared, then, based on the input from the others above, I’d imagine the issue is related to some text/language. However, if the whole screen went black (not just text area), do you know which screen that went black? Is it the very first screen (after the Default.png)? Or is it that the Default.png never appeared and simply black screen appeared? If it’s a specific screen that went black, I imagine it would make it easier to narrow down the culprit.

Just to let you know…
Resubmitted the same app, the only change being that I uncommented a couple of print statements on the main.lua file so that it was demonstrably a different byte size.
(So now the log will have some pointless entries)

I asked Apple to do an expedited review.
2 days later they agreed, and its now live on the app store.
